Activities

Student Activities:choral groups, dance, drama/theater, pep band, student government, student newspaper, student film society, yearbook

Organizations and Clubs

Number of registered student organizations: 70

Honor societies: Silver Key Honor Society, Golden Quill Honor Society, Alpha Beta Kappa, Special Honors And Awards Program (SHARP);

Religious organizations: (Appears as submitted by school) The Newmen Club, Christian Student Felloship, Hillel

International organizations: (Appears as submitted by school) African Student Association, Black Student Alliance, Caribbean Student Association, Dominican Student Association, International Club, Latino American Club. National Societies of Minorities in Hospitalities; National Society of Black Engineers



Other organizations: (Appears as submitted by school) University Involvement Board, Ski Club accounting association, ad club, american culinary federation, american marketing association, anime club, association for operations management (APICS), bacchus club, ballroom/latin dance club, black student association, BCV capoeira ? ? ? grupo ondas, best buddies, billiards club, (petitioning), bread club (petitioning), caribbean student association, chippers club, christian student fellowship, club of culinary excellence, club managers association of america, collegiate entrepreneurship organization, collegiate honor society, criminal justice association, dominican student association, elite fashion association, equine club, financial management association food science club, hit squad, impact, interfraternity council, international association of assembly managers (IAAM), international club, j-brew, johnson & wales commUNITY alliance, jr. american culinary federation (ACF), national association for the advancement of colored people (NAACP), national pan-hellenic council, national student organization (NSO), nutrition society, outdoor adventure club (petitioning), pastry arts club, professional convention management association (PCMA), rotaract international, ski and snowboard club, society for the advancement of management (SAM), society for human resource management (SHRM), special functions club, student government association, tongue fu, travel and tourism club

Student Newspaper(s): (Appears as submitted by school) The Campus Herald, bi-weekly.

Fraternities

Number of fraternities: 7
Fraternities with chapter houses: 0
Percentage of students that are fraternity members: 3%

Sororities

Number of sororities: 7
Sororities with chapter houses: 0
Percentage of students that are sorority members: 4%
